Agriculture Mulch Films

Mulch films offer a variety of soil-enhancing benefits and have become increasingly popular. These thick, pigment papers prevent weed growth, minimize moisture loss and maximize yield by adjusting the temperature accordingly – all while withstanding intense solar radiation. But to ensure these protective features remain strong, they must be built on reliable light & thermal stabilizers that are resistant against chemicals.

Advantages

  • It prevents soil moisture and water loss.
  • It helps in facilitating fertilizer placement and lessen the loss of plant nutrients through leaching.
  • Mulch provides a barrier to soil pathogens.
  • Opaque mulch blocks the sunlight and prevents germination of annual weeds.
  • Mulch films benefits in early and quality growth of many vegetables like tomatoes and peppers.

PET

Polyethylene Terephthalate, commonly known as PET is one of the most widely used plastics in the world. As a raw material, it is globally recognized as safe, non-toxic and is 100% recyclable. It is strong, durable, environment-friendly, and has a very high clarity with excellent water barrier properties.
